Negative potential energy in physics signifies that the object is in a lower energy state compared to a reference point. This means that work would need to be done to move the object to a higher energy state.

What does the term "mgh" signify in the field of physics?

In the field of physics, the term "mgh" signifies the potential energy of an object due to its height above the ground. It is calculated by multiplying the mass of the object (m), the acceleration due to gravity (g), and the height (h) above the ground.


Why have to put minus sign before the formula of gravitational potential?

The negative sign in the formula for gravitational potential energy is used to signify that the potential energy is defined as zero at an infinite distance from the gravitational source. It allows for the interpretation that as objects move closer together, their potential energy decreases and is considered negative in relation to the reference point.


What does the term "omega" signify in the field of physics?

In physics, the term "omega" typically signifies angular velocity or angular frequency, which refers to the rate at which an object rotates or oscillates around a fixed point.


What does the term "delta u" signify in the field of physics?

In physics, the term "delta u" represents the change in internal energy of a system. It is often used in thermodynamics to describe the difference in energy before and after a process or reaction.

What does the term "s-1" signify in the context of mathematics or physics?

The term "s-1" signifies the unit of frequency in mathematics or physics, representing the inverse of seconds. It is commonly used to measure how many cycles or events occur per second.


What does the term "negative enthalpy" signify in the context of thermodynamics and how does it impact the overall energy of a system?

In thermodynamics, "negative enthalpy" indicates that a system has released heat energy. This can lower the overall energy of the system, making it more stable.
